Abstract
NUEVO PROCESO PARA LA PRODUCCION EN MASA DE MICROBULBOS Y MINIBULBOS DE AJO LIBRES DE VIRUS A TRAVES DE TECNICAS DE CULTIVO TISULAR DE PLANTAS, QUE COMPRENDE LAS ETAPAS DE: DERIVAR CALLOS DE LOS MERISTEMAS APICALES DE DIENTES DE AJO; REGENERAR VASTAGOS REGENERADOS; MULTIPLICAR LOS MULTIVASTAGOS A TRAVES DE SUBCULTIVOS REPETITIVOS; FORMAR MICROBULBOS LIBRES DE VIRUS A TRAVES DEL CULTIVO TISULAR DE LA PLANTA; Y, FINALMENTE, FORMAR MINIBULBOS LIBRES DE VIRUS A TRAVES DE CULTIVO DE MULTIVASTAGOS EN CAMPO ABIERTO, CON LO QUE PUEDE MEJORARSE MUCHO EL RENDIMIENTO DE LA PRODUCCION CON UNA DISMINUCION DE ETAPAS, UNA MAYOR VELOCIDAD DE MULTIPLICACION DE LOS VASTAGOS, UN MENOR NUMERO DE ETAPAS DEL PROCESO Y TAMBIEN UN AUMENTO DE LA DENSIDAD DE LOS VASTAGOS EN UN RECIPIENTE DE CULTIVO.
